Transaction 40eab56a4676475626abcba833cc08a759110a49c5d238bfe8437dd86aac1431

1 Input
2 Outputs
  • 40eab56a4676475626abcba833cc08a759110a49c5d238bfe8437dd86aac1431:0
  • value  4000000
    address  39wUeZ7pt1nBzVyWaeFVv5aQzYjGkqYYhK
  • 40eab56a4676475626abcba833cc08a759110a49c5d238bfe8437dd86aac1431:1
  • value  50483600
    address  bc1qll56y9a963uyuxukz9c9meljs3uu4s9p9fuezy